5 minutes ago, Catch-22 said:

Why not get a Magnetospeed? The accuracy and repeatability is almost on par with the Labradar according to Litz.

Super easy to use and won’t affect barrel harmonics when used with the MK picatinny mount.

Had a US Spec Labradar but now use a V3 Magnetospeed and MK Mount.

The mini-USB power lead socket on the Labradar is ridiculously flimsy for such a piece of equipment............a standard USB would have made more sense. I'm looking at ways to modify mine.
